
A native Marylander, Bill Reightler offers unique experience with over 45 years in the Thoroughbred business, He founded Bill Reightler Bloodstock in 1999, and over the past 20 years has established himself as one of the leading sales and bloodstock agents based in the Mid-Atlantic region.
After training horses at Mid-Atlantic tracks for 10 years, Bill worked at Spendthrift Farm in Lexington, Kentucky, in the training, broodmare and stud divisions for five years. He then returned to Maryland to manage Ross Valley Farms (now Marathon Farms), where he built the farm and handled a top band of broodmares that included champions Heavenly Cause and Smart Angle. During his tenure at Ross Valley, he raised and prepped Houston (a $2.9 million sales yearling) and several stakes horses, including Two Punch.
After five years at Ross Valley, Bill accepted a management position at Chanceland Farm. There he built the farm and helped establish it as a leading operation in the region.
As a sales agent, his accomplishments include selling Knicks Go (2021 Eclipse Champion Horse of the Year), Declan’s Moon (2003 Eclipse Champion 2 year old ), owning and racing stakes winner Pagan Moon, owning and selling Rockcide, half-sister to champion Funnycide, carrying in utero multiple stakes winner Rule. More recently, sales and mating accomplishments include multiple Grade 1 multi-millionaire KNICKS GO, G1 ARMY MULE, and BRACKET BUSTER.
